In today's dynamic technological landscape, the demand for skilled data scientists is at an all-time high. To truly excel in this competitive field, aspiring professionals need to embrace a full stack approach. This entails not only possessing powerful analytical skills but also mastering the art of coding and data visualization. By bridging the gap between theory and practice, full stack data scientists can unlock actionable insights from complex datasets and drive data-driven decision-making across diverse industries.
A comprehensive understanding of programming languages such as Python, R, or SQL is essential for manipulating and analyzing data. Coupled with this technical proficiency are the critical thinking skills needed to interpret patterns, identify trends, and build predictive models. Furthermore, effective communication of findings is crucial for conveying complex data stories to both technical and non-technical audiences.
